USA Weekly Chart Week Ending 17th Mar 2012

Hardware:

X360 - 62,850 (0%)
PS3 - 47,437 (-4%)
3DS - 46,322 (+1%)
Wii - 33,010 (-5%)
PSV - 29,957 (-16%)
DS - 18,067 (-8%)
PSP - 5,273 (-16%)

Software:

1: (X360) Mass Effect 3 - 200,521
2: (PS3) Tales of Graces f - 127,783
3: (Wii) Mario Party 9 - 106,722
4: (X360) Silent Hill: Downpour - 68,025
5: (PS3) Silent Hill: Downpour - 64,797
6: (X360) Call of Duty: Modern Warfare 3 - 62,821
7: (PS3) Naruto Shippuden: Ultimate Ninja STORM Generations - 60,674
8: (Wii) Just Dance 3 - 58,784
9: (PS3) Mass Effect 3 - 57,596
10: (X360) Naruto Shippuden: Ultimate Ninja STORM Generations - 44,518

Ranking the Devil May Cry Series

VGChartz's Mark Nielsen: "Upon finally finishing Devil May Cry 5 recently - after it spent several years on my “I’ll play that soon” list - I considered giving it a fittingly-named Late Look article. However, considering that this was indeed the final piece I was missing in the DMC puzzle, I decided to instead take this opportunity to take a look back at the entirety of this genre-defining series and rank the entries. What also made this a particularly tempting notion was that while most high-profile series have developed fairly evenly over time, with a few bumps on the road, the history of Devil May Cry has, at least in my eyes, been an absolute roller coaster, with everything from total disasters to action game gold."
